Career path

Volunteer Coordinator: Responsible for overseeing volunteer activities, ensuring effective risk management practices are followed to protect both volunteers and the organization.

Risk Management Specialist: Focuses on identifying, analyzing, and mitigating potential risks associated with volunteer programs while maintaining compliance with legal standards.

Compliance Officer: Ensures that all volunteer programs adhere to regulations and policies, implementing strategies to minimize risk and enhance safety.

Community Engagement Manager: Works to foster relationships with community partners, promoting safe volunteer opportunities and minimizing potential liabilities.

Training and Development Manager: Designs and delivers training programs focused on risk management strategies for volunteers, ensuring all participants are well-prepared to handle potential challenges.
